In 2020 we started looking for a piece of land to use as a getaway for our family. From the moment I set foot on this property I was IN LOVE! It just felt different, being in the fresh air and experiencing the beauty of nature, changed me. In Spring of 2022, with the help of my girls, we planted 6 - 50 foot rows of annual flowers, a small plot of lavender and a 1/2 acre field of sunflowers. Watching the beauty that came from planting the tiniest seeds was incredible and now I’m hooked!
Fall 2022 I decided to go “all in” on expanding the flower farm. I have added a field of peonies, fancy narcissus, bearded iris, hydrangeas and an {ever growing} collection of roses.
We also have a great selection of annual flowers which will include: amaranth, celosia, cosmos, dahlias, lisianthus, strawflowers, sunflowers, and zinnias!
We are looking forward to this year and sharing the beauty of our farm with others through bouquet sales, U-Picks as well as a few private events.
